1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are parallel lines?
Back
Lines that are always the same distance apart and never meet.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are perpendicular lines?
Back
Lines that intersect to form right angles (90 degrees).
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What do we call lines that intersect?
Back
Intersecting lines.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How can you identify parallel lines in a drawing?
Back
They will never cross and will remain the same distance apart.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the angle formed by perpendicular lines?
Back
90 degrees.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
If two lines are always one inch apart and do not intersect, what are they called?
Back
Parallel lines.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the difference between parallel and perpendicular lines?
Back
Parallel lines never meet, while perpendicular lines intersect at right angles.
